InvalidOperatioException при разработке приложения Microsoft Surface 2.0 - PullRequest
1 голос
/ 19 июля 2011

Я занимаюсь разработкой приложения Microsoft Surface 2.0 с использованием Visual C # 2010 Express Edition.Я уже установил Surface 2.0 SDK и среду выполнения на Windows 7 (32-разрядная версия).

Из установленных шаблонов я выбираю новое приложение Surface WPF и нажимаю F5.Я получаю InvalidOperationException со следующим сообщением -

Невозможно загрузить данные имени счетчика, поскольку из реестра считан неверный индекс «Службы терминалов».

Проектпустой.Я еще не добавил ни одной строки кода.Это же пустое приложение отлично работает на другом настольном компьютере с Visual Studio 2010 Ultimate.

Ответы [ 2 ]

2 голосов
/ 13 февраля 2012

Запустите lodctr.exe /r, он восстановит записи реестра, связанные со счетчиками perfmon.

2 голосов
/ 19 июля 2011

Сначала я бы попробовал: PerformanceCounters в .NET 4.0 и Windows 7

Скорее всего, счетчики производительности не загружаются в реестр или, по крайней мере, загружены неправильно. Я знаю, что вопрос в другом, но симптомы те же.

...